It seems as though everyone has been doing hood vents and other "keep cool" mods, so I decided to play along. In tossing around a few ideas I came across one that seemed so stupid and ridiculous that I immediately dismissed it. The idea has been tormenting me so I decided to see it through. I couldnt' find any pictures of other cherokees with a similar setup which made me more interested and makes it seem unique. Anyways I wanted to see what you all thought about my hood vent. Let the criticism or compliments roll. My flame suit is on.























Let me just mention, I suck at cutting straight lines and what not so.... Also, yes im aware it's off center to the passenger side a little. I had to put it that way to clear my K&N air collector thing there....haha.

Quote: Whyd you do one in the middle?

well, i thought about doing two, one on each side about the same level but without cutting the bottom out of the drvr side one it wouldn't clear the K&N intake. I played with the idea of doing it offset to the one side but figured more vital electronics are over there so i picked the middle. not optimal due to the crease in the hood right down the middle but figured it would take care of the three things i was after. To use this style of vent, to have something a little different, and most importantly so it would still be functional.
